Text
The state hereby pledges and agrees with the holders of any bonds issued under
this part 5 and with those parties who enter into contracts with the authority or any
member of the combination pursuant to this part 5 that the state will not limit, alter,
restrict, or impair the rights vested in the authority or the rights or obligations of
any person with which it contracts to fulfill the terms of any agreements made
pursuant to this part 5. The state further agrees that it will not in any way impair the
rights or remedies of the holders of any bonds of the authority until such bonds
have been paid or until adequate provision for payment has been made. The
authority may include this provision and undertaking for the state in such bonds.
